Output 69c56ba29382b16be133b48ee9d33f4476bdf7b34a95aa1e5ccd7d8a0d80af74:3

value
539125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b857f2755014b6568abecc2c1f69b5f96e31c4 OP_EQUAL
address
34mK4HfQwk91nSumYhHnF7B3s6STvwsVq3
transaction
69c56ba29382b16be133b48ee9d33f4476bdf7b34a95aa1e5ccd7d8a0d80af74
spent
true